Los últimos tutoriales de desarrollo web
 

ASP Componente AdRotator


ASP Componente AdRotator

El componente ASP AdRotator crea un objeto AdRotator que muestra una imagen diferente cada vez que un usuario entra o actualiza una página. Un archivo de texto incluye información sobre las imágenes.

Nota: El AdRotator no funciona con Internet Information Server 7 (IIS7) .

Sintaxis

<%
set adrotator=server.createobject("MSWC.AdRotator")
adrotator.GetAdvertisement("textfile.txt")
%>

ASP AdRotator Ejemplo

Supongamos que tenemos el siguiente archivo de texto, llamado "ads.txt" :

REDIRECT banners.asp
*
w3s.gif
http://www.w3ii.com
Free Tutorials from w3ii
50
xmlspy.gif
http://www.altova.com
XML Editor from Altova
50

Las líneas debajo del asterisco en el archivo de texto anterior especifica el nombre de las imágenes (ads) que se mostrará, las direcciones de hipervínculo, el texto alternativo (for the images) , y las tasas de visualización (in percent) .

La primera línea del archivo de texto anterior especifica qué sucede cuando un usuario hace clic en una de las imágenes. La página de redirección (banners.asp) recibirá una cadena de consulta con la dirección URL para redirigir a.

Tip: Para especificar la altura, la anchura y borde de la imagen, puede insertar las siguientes líneas bajo REDIRECT:

REDIRECT banners.asp
WIDTH 468
HEIGHT 60
BORDER 0
*
w3s.gif
...

El "banners.asp" archivo es como sigue:

Ejemplo

<%
url=Request.QueryString("url")
If url<>"" then Response.Redirect(url)
%>

<!DOCTYPE html>
<html>
<body>
<%
set adrotator=Server.CreateObject("MSWC.AdRotator")
response.write(adrotator.GetAdvertisement("textfile.txt"))
%>
</body>
</html>

Mostrar Ejemplo »

¡¡Eso es todo!!


ASP Propiedades AdRotator

Propiedad Descripción Ejemplo
Frontera Especifica el tamaño de los bordes alrededor de la publicidad <%
establecer adrot = Server. CreateObject("MSWC.AdRotator")
adrot.Border = "2"
Respuesta. Write(adrot.GetAdvertisement("ads.txt") )
%>
se puede hacer clic Especifica si el anuncio es un hipervínculo <%
establecer adrot = Server. CreateObject("MSWC.AdRotator")
adrot.Clickable = false
Respuesta. Write(adrot.GetAdvertisement("ads.txt") )
%>
TargetFrame Nombre del marco para mostrar el anuncio <%
establecer adrot = Server. CreateObject("MSWC.AdRotator")
adrot.TargetFrame = "target = '_ blank'"
Response.Write (adrot.GetAdvertisement ( "ads.txt"))
%>

Métodos AdRotator ASP

Método Descripción Ejemplo
GetAdvertisement Devuelve HTML que muestra el anuncio en la página <%
set adrot=Server. CreateObject("MSWC.AdRotator")
Response. Write(adrot.GetAdvertisement("ads.txt") )
%>